titleOfInvention | Method for producing aluminum borate whiskers |
abstract | (57) [Summary] [Object] To provide a method for efficiently producing a long-length aluminum borate whisker having a coloring effect as well as a reinforcing effect. [Composition] A mixture containing one or more additives containing at least one of Si, Mn, Fe, Co, Ni, Cu, Zn and Bi components, an aluminum component feed material, a boron component containing material and a melting agent. A method for producing an aluminum borate-based whisker characterized by heat treatment, which has a coloring effect as well as a reinforcing effect, and can efficiently produce a long aluminum borate-based whisker filler. it can. |
